Introduction to the job

We are searching for a Senior Financial Analyst to partner with our R&D team in SD. In this role, you will be working with engineering teams engaged in the development of our leading edge EUV technology that supports the latest semiconductor production capabilities.

Using our core values of challenge, collaborate and care, you will work with department leaders to develop and manage operating and capital expenses, ensuring resources are allocated to the most critical projects, and optimizing decisions to achieve desired outcomes. You will work with the local finance team members and our global finance teams to drive process improvement and thought leadership.

This position requires access to controlled technology, as defined in the Export Administration Regulations (15 C.F.R. § 730, et seq.). Qualified candidates must be legally authorized to access such controlled technology prior to beginning work. Business demands may require ASML to proceed with candidates who are immediately eligible to access controlled technology.

Role and responsibilities

  • Act as financial business partner to Development and Engineering and program management group for ASML SD EUV activities.
  • Support full set of FP&A and general close activities for R&D organization and project reporting.
  • Participate in annual plan and quarterly financial forecast process by coordinating with all levels of management to gather, analyze, and project operational trends and program priorities.
  • Partner with Program Management Organization to manage risks and opportunities and identify solutions to achieving desired outcomes.
  • Generate and develop reporting to support improved financial awareness of project managers.
  • Assist in the development of monthly packages to be utilized for financial management reporting, including variance explanations, forecast updates, scenario building and other analyses.
  • Conducts review of capital investments for ROI and works with teams to optimize returns.
  • Engages development team to stay aware of key program changes that impact other operational organization and builds necessary alignment.
  • Makes recommendations to management regarding cost savings or profit generating opportunities and profitability improvement strategies.
  • Establishes and maintains databases of pertinent information for analysis.
  • Analyzes financial information to determine present and future financial performance.
  • Supports the development and implementation of processes, procedures, control and/or action planning for conducting special studies to analyze complex financial models or situations.
  • Works closely with assigned organizations to develop tools, analysis and metrics that enable targeted financial performance.
  • Provides support for month/year end close.
